Scottish Seniors Golfing Society 2017 fixtures


The Scottish Seniors Golfing Society has again arranged an excellent fixture list for the coming seasson, including two additional events for Super Seniors (over 65 years of age).

Graham Bell (Downfield) will be hoping to repeat his 2016 Order of Merit title win, but will face strong competition from fellow members of the Scotland team who won the Senior European Championship in Slovenia last September. 


They include last year's Order of Merit runner-up, and 2015 champion, Ronnie Clark (Erskine), and 2014 winner Ian Brotherston (Dumfries and County).


The Scottish Seniors Golfing Society is the brainchild of former amateur international Gordon MacDonald, and celebrates its 10th anniversary this year.  It was formed to meet the demand for high level competition for senior amateur golfers still keen to test their game against the top players.




Full SSGS fixture list for 2017 is:
April 28/29  -  Spring meeting (Monifieth).
May 11/12  -  North of Scotland Open (Tain).
June 1/2  -  East of Scotland Open (Edzell).
June 21-23  - Scottish Golf Ltd Senior Open (Royal Burgess).
June 22/23  -  Super Seniors' summer meeting (Stirling).
June 29/30 -  West of Scotland Open (West Kilbride).
July 6/7  -  Central Scotland Open (Glenbervie).
July 10-14  -  Match-play Championship (Alyth).
July 27/28   -  South of Scotland Open (Powfoot).
August 17/18   -  Super Seniors' Open (Largs).
August 24/25 -  Autumn meeting (Strathmore).
September 7/8  -  Super Seniors' autumn meeting (Ladybank).
September 15  -  Finals Day (Blairgowrie).
September 22  -  Area Team Championship (Forfar).
